Buyuk Ipak Yuli
Railway stop
Buyuk Ipak Yoli is a station of the Tashkent Metro, the northern terminus of Chilonzor Line. It was opened on 18 August 1980 as part of the second section of Chilonzor Line, between October inkilobi and Maksim Gor'kiy. Buyuk Ipak Yuli is situated 3 km west of ДУРДОНА.
Yashnabad
Metro station
Photo: Sick Spiny,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Yashnobod is a Tashkent Metro station on Circle Line. It was opened on 30 August 2020 as part of the inaugural section of the line between Texnopark and Qoʻylik. Yashnabad is situated 2½ km south of ДУРДОНА.

Salar
Town
Salar is a town in Tashkent Region, Uzbekistan. It is part of Qibray District. In 1989, the town had a population of 25,521. The town is home to the Inter Rohat Brewery. Salar is situated 6 km north of ДУРДОНА.
